tryptyk
Polish
Etymology
Borrowed from French triptyque.
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ˈtrɘp.tɘk/
Audio: (file) - Rhymes: -ɘptɘk
- Syllabification: tryp‧tyk
Noun
tryptyk m inan (related adjective tryptykowy)
- (art, Roman Catholicism) triptych (altar decorated with paintings and bas-reliefs, with a fixed main part inside and two closed side wings connected by hinges)
- Hypernym: ołtarz
- Coordinate terms: dyptyk, poliptyk
- (film, literature, music, painting, theater) triptych (work that consists of three parts)
- Synonym: trylogia
